Cuningham House

Cuningham House was opened in 1923 as a result of a bequest by Mr G A C Cuningham. It is a large, stately structure of architectural importance and is listed with the New Zealand Historic Places Trust. A spacious staircase leads to a large peripheral gallery where an extensive collection of tropical plants are displayed. Both upper and lower Cuningham House share collections including Dieffenbachia, Peperomia, Hoya, Anthurium and Dracaena.
